Skeena Gold + Silver Limited is a Canadian mining company with a portfolio of exploration and development projects located in northwest British Columbia, Canada. Our current focus is on the revitalization of the high-grade, past-producing Eskay Creek gold-silver mine. Reporting to the Director, Engineering, the Project Manager will drive the scoping, engineering, design, and handover to construction of significant project components in both the Process Plant and Infrastructure areas. The Project Manager will play a pivotal role on the Eskay Creek Project, shaping and delivering specific projects within the Construction & Engineering group.
